Dimiribadi Population - Nayagarh, Orissa
Dimiribadi is a very small village located in Ranapur Block of Nayagarh district, Orissa with total 7 families residing. The Dimiribadi village has population of 41 of which 17 are males while 24 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Dimiribadi village population of children with age 0-6 is 9 which makes up 21.95 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dimiribadi village is 1412 which is higher than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Dimiribadi as per census is 2000, higher than Orissa average of 941.
Dimiribadi village has lower liter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Dimiribadi village was 37.50 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Dimiribadi Male literacy stands at 57.14 % while female literacy rate was 22.22 %.

Dimiribadi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 7 | - | - |
Population | 41 | 17 | 24 |
Child (0-6) | 9 | 3 | 6 |
Schedule Caste | 1 | 1 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 40 | 16 | 24 |
Literacy | 37.50 % | 57.14 % | 22.22 % |
Total Workers | 28 | 13 | 15 |
Main Worker | 7 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 21 | 6 | 15 |
